Chameleone’s 10 Years of Music
By SD • Feb 20th, 2010 • Category: Hot GossipJose Chameleone will be reflecting on his music career today at KCC Grounds, Lugogo at his Basiima Ogenze show. Despite the ups and downs, he has been entertaining his fans for a decade. “I am putting the highlights of my career together on this show,” he says.
Chameleone will hold other concerts tomorrow at Collin Hotel in Mukono and Resort Beach in Entebbe. The concert posters, with the inscription “overdose” and Chameleone in medical garb and cornrows, tells the controversies.
“I realised Ugandan music is going to another level and this is a way of rebranding. I am telling people they can be all they want to be. That means even a medical doctor can be a musician. No one should stop you,” he says. He says after 10 years of using limited resources, it is time he raised the bar. The first step is to use better equipment.
“I am going to use the same stage that R.Kelly used. R.Kelly disappointed people and left. Chameleone is here for life and cannot disappoint his fans,” he says.
The concert will take us through his musical journey that should end with his latest songs like Vumulia and the highly-regarded, Basiima Ogenze. Bedridden Bebe Cool is going to have his first outing today since the unfortunate shooting. But whether he performs or not depends on doctors’ orders.
